Folio Honors D Magazine Visionaries

An industry pub considers our leadership among the top media business innovators.
|

Folio is a magazine industry publication, and next month it’s recognizing what’s called the Folio: 100, media’s “most innovative entrepreneurs and market shaker-uppers.” If you peruse the list of honorees, you’ll see folks from many top national titles and brands, largely big-shots out of New York City.

Scroll on down to the group categorized as “Visionaries” though, and right there at the top you’ll find our own D Magazine Partners president Christine Allison and chairman/editor in chief Wick Allison.

All of us who are lucky enough to work here recognize what a unique company this is. Christine and Wick aren’t afraid to take chances and to give any promising idea a shot. They’re always looking for a new angle on this business and early on recognized the need to transform what was once a single-title paper-and-ink business into a still-expanding digital enterprise.

I asked Christine what this means to her:

“It’s an honor, to be sure, but we couldn’t do what we do in any other city. To be acknowledged nationally is a big nod to Dallas and our incredible staff.”
